A CLINICAL ASSESSMENT OF THE EFFICACY OF LODHRADI LEPA IN PATIENTS WITH TARUNYA PITIKA
Dr. Jayshri Sahu*, Dr. Rashmi Pradhan, Dr. Akila Begum, Dr. Vaibhav Shingne
ABSTRACT
Acne is a common dermatological condition predominantly affecting adolescents and young adults. As it mainly involves the face, it can adversely affect physical appearance and may consequently lead to psychological concerns such as feelings of inferiority, anxiety, reduced self-confidence, and social withdrawal. Its high prevalence and significant impact on quality of life, along with the limitations associated with available therapeutic options, have increased interest in Ayurveda and herbal-based approaches to skin care. In view of these considerations, the present study was undertaken to evaluate the therapeutic efficacy of Lodhradi Lepa in the management of Tarunya Pitika (Acne Vulgaris).
